2010-04-30 97 views
3

我正在寻找将ASP.NET 2.0应用程序更改为Mono框架的可能性。我使用了Mono Migration Analyzer工具,它检测到一些P/Invoke和interop依赖关系。在Windows上的.NET到Ubuntu上的Mono

例如:

1)我们使用Excel互操作性展示,并在Linux上,我们正在寻找使用使用OpenOffice/StarOffice来代替。使用StarOffice替代Excel是否有一种简单的方法? (我知道这听起来很奇怪,但我只是不想错过任何人已经做过的事。)

2)LDAP认证:什么可能是Ubuntu的最佳选择(或其他风格的Linux )?

3)是否有Mono的Ajax框架?最好使用与Atlas类似的控件?

我希望我不要好高骛远这里..

+0

“我希望我在这里没有太大的野心。” - 如果不是雄心勃勃,我们仍然会带着俱乐部 - 或者更糟糕的是,在泥里爬行。 – IAbstract 2010-04-30 03:47:12

回答

1

1)是的,有一个Mono互操作层用于OpenOffice。这不是非常友好,但它的工作原理。

2)如果你只是想从你的应用程序中使用LDAP,那么Mono附带有一个Novell.Directory.Ldap库,可能还有其他的。

3)单声道包括ASP.NET AJAX。还有其他一些库,如Gaia AJAX。

+0

我正在寻找在Ubuntu上转向单声道,因此interops会去折腾。我正在寻找Linux中Interops的替代方法,即如何在Linux中创建openoffice scalc对象? – 2010-05-05 01:08:27

+0

OpenOffice interop层也可以在Windows上使用.NET,您可以在线找到多篇文章。 – 2010-05-15 00:23:07

0

好了,找到了对Linux的LDAP替代 - http://www.openldap.org/” ALT = “OpenLDAP的”> OpenLDAP的。 如果有人能够分享将角色和用户从Windows Active Directory迁移到OpenLDAP的经验,这将会很有帮助。如果有人在ASP.NET中使用OpenLDAP。

相关问题